NEW HYDE PARK, NY — New Hyde Park voters headed to the polls Tuesday to cast ballots for Nassau County district attorney and Legislature, as well as key races in both Town of North Hempstead and Town of Hempstead.

Incumbents Madeline Singas, Richard Nicolello and Vincent Muscarella all successfully defended their seats Tuesday, as did Judi Bosworth in the Town of North Hempstead. Republican Tom Muscarella also earned a victory over Thomas Tweedy for Hempstead Town council in District 2, while Vincent Muscarella cruised past Barbara Hafner in the Legislature's 8th District.

In the Town of Hempstead supervisor race, Democratic incumbent Laura Gillen trailed Don Clavin. Clavin claimed victory in a Facebook post, writing he was "humbled and proud" to serve as the next supervisor.

"Thank you to everyone for all of the support during this campaign," he said. "Now, let's get to work!"

In the North Hempstead supervisor race, GOP challenger Redmond said his team was "highly disappointed" in the results. He believes the odds were against him from the start.

"I knew going in we were up against a stacked deck, but that is never a good excuse not to fight for you," he wrote in a Facebook post. "In fact, we've inspired too many people along the way to ever give up."

Redmond added that his campaign aimed to give people a voice to air their concerns with local government.

In the Legislature District 8 race, Hafner thanked her supporters and conceded defeat to Vincent Muscarella.

"You win some and you learn some," she said, adding: "I can only hope the incumbents who have been elected reach out to all of our communities and truly represent the people they serve in the county."
